1. Data Privacy and Student Information Risks
Scholastic collects vast amounts of data through its digital platforms and subscription-based tools. While intended to personalize learning and improve engagement, this data harvesting sparks serious privacy concerns — especially regarding minors. Without transparent clarity on how student information is stored, shared, or monetized, parents may unknowingly expose their children to risks like identity theft, profiling, or misuse in third-party algorithms.

2. Hidden Costs Behind Seemingly Free Resources
Many popular Scholastic reading programs and eBooks are advertised as “free” or low-cost, but many include hidden fees or require recurring payments for full access. Children’s subscription kits, teacher toolboxes, and supplemental digital packs often accrue charges after a free trial — leading to unexpected expenses for families already stretched thin.
3. Marketing That Overpromises and Underdelivers
Scholastic’s marketing frequently positions its materials as “essential” for academic success, sometimes exaggerating their impact on learning outcomes. Projects aimed at boosting reading comprehension or STEM skills may lack rigorous scientific backing, leaving parents convinced of unsubstantiated benefits.
4. Limited Transparency on Curriculum Alignment
Despite extensive outreach, Scholastic’s educational support materials don’t always clearly align with state standards or specific school curricula. This mismatch can cause confusion, redundancy, or gaps in learning — particularly in critical subjects where consistent, verified content is vital.

What You Can Do: 5 Essential Steps for Parental Awareness
- Review Privacy Policies Carefully – Before enrolling in Scholastic’s digital programs, read their privacy statement, especially sections about data collection, sharing, and deletion rights.
2. Audit Subscriptions Regularly – Turn off auto-renewals, and cancel any underused tools to prevent hidden billing.
3. Cross-Check Educational Claims – Look for independent reviews or research on Scholastic’s reading programs and digital tools.
4. Advocate for Transparency – Reach out to Scholastic with questions about data use, pricing, and curricular alignment.
5. Explore Alternatives – Compare Scholastic’s offerings with nonprofit, open-source, or publicly vetted educational platforms that emphasize student privacy.
